In part #1 of this 2-part series, Paul Smith bestselling author of "Sell With A Story" reveals a powerful NEW method for making your case presentation process more effective and your practice more profitable.

While the idea of using storytelling to get more patients to accept your treatment plans and make your practice profitable isn’t new, Smith reveals what a “sales story” is; how they make convincing patients to accept your recommendations easier and why you want to use them. 

He reveals the most effective sales (i.e. "persuasion") stories you should use and how to craft and deliver them for maximum profitability in you practice.
